As a business owner, choosing the right software can feel like deciding between buying a ready-made suit or having a tailor create one just for you. Both will cover your needs, but one fits perfectly and lasts longer while the other is quick and convenient, i.e., A SaaS or a Custom software?
If you are evaluating whether to work with a custom software development company or choose an existing SaaS solution, this article will help you make the right decision with regards to the business requirements in 2026.
What is Software as a Service
Software as a Service, or SaaS, is software you access online without installing it on your systems. You usually pay a subscription fee and start using it immediately.
Common examples include CRM platforms, accounting software, marketing tools, and project management systems. Thousands of businesses use the same product, just like buying a ready-made suit off the rack.
Benefits of SaaS
SaaS is like renting a furnished apartment. You move in and everything is ready to go:
- Fast setup and implementation
- Lower upfront cost
- Automatic updates and maintenance
- Easy to scale users
- Minimal technical knowledge required
Limitations of SaaS
Just as you cannot alter the walls in a rented apartment, SaaS has limits:
- Limited customization
- Recurring subscription costs
- Integration challenges with existing systems
- Data control limitations
- Features you do not need but still pay for
Over time, many businesses find SaaS doesn’t perfectly fit their unique processes.
What is Custom Software
Custom software is built specifically for your business, like having a tailor craft a suit that fits every curve perfectly. A custom software development company works with you to understand your needs before creating a tailored solution.
A software product development company develops software that aligns seamlessly with your operations, rather than forcing your business to adapt to pre-built tools.
Benefits of Custom Software
- Tailored precisely to your business
- Scalable for long-term growth
- Seamless integrations with existing systems
- Competitive advantage
- Ownership and control of data
- Improved efficiency and automation
Businesses often turn to a custom software development company in Toronto when they outgrow SaaS solutions.
Limitations of Custom Software
- Higher initial investment
- Longer development timeline
- Requires planning and collaboration
However, the long-term value usually outweighs the upfront cost.
SaaS vs Custom Software Comparison
| Feature | SaaS | Custom Software |
| Flexibility | Limited, like an off-the-rack suit | Fully tailored, fits your business perfectly |
| Cost | Lower upfront, ongoing subscription | Higher upfront, lower long-term cost |
| Scalability | May limit growth | Grows with your business |
| Integration | Can be challenging | Seamless with existing systems |
| Competitive Advantage | Standard for everyone | Unique business advantage |
When SaaS is the Right Choice
SaaS suits businesses with standard workflows:
- Basic CRM requirements
- Simple project management
- Accounting software
- Marketing automation
If your business operations resemble most companies, SaaS can work well.
When Custom Software is the Right Choice
Custom software is ideal for businesses with unique needs:
- Enterprise application development
- Customer portals
- Internal automation systems
- Inventory management solutions
- Business intelligence dashboards
- Integration platforms
A custom software development Toronto company can design solutions to match your workflows perfectly.
Why Businesses Choose a Custom Software Development Company in Toronto
Toronto is a hub for technology and innovation. Choosing a custom software Toronto provider offers:
- Local collaboration and support
- Understanding of regional business needs
- Access to experienced developers
- Long-term partnership opportunities
Software development consulting services also help plan a technology strategy before building.
The Role of Software Development Consulting Services
Consulting services evaluate whether SaaS or custom software fits best. They analyze workflows, spot inefficiencies, and recommend solutions.
Services include:
- Technology strategy planning
- System architecture design
- Software evaluation
- Integration planning
- Digital transformation roadmap
A software product development company often provides consulting to ensure your investment delivers measurable results.
Hybrid Approach: SaaS Plus Custom Software
Some businesses combine SaaS and custom software, using SaaS for standard processes and custom solutions for unique workflows:
- SaaS for email marketing
- Custom software for operations management
- SaaS for accounting
- Custom software for analytics
This balances cost with flexibility.
Questions Business Owners Should Ask
- Does my business have unique workflows?
- Will we need to scale quickly?
- Are we using multiple disconnected tools?
- Is data integration important?
- Do we want long-term cost efficiency?
If you answered yes, custom software may be the better choice.
SaaS vs Custom Software in 2026
In 2026, automation, integration, and scalability are priorities. SaaS is convenient, but many businesses move toward custom software to gain a competitive edge.
Advancements in cloud computing, AI, and automation have made custom software more accessible than ever.
Final Thoughts
Choosing between SaaS and custom software depends on your business goals and operational complexity.
- SaaS is great for quick deployment and standard needs.
- Custom software is ideal for growth, efficiency, and uniqueness.
A custom software development company in Toronto, paired with software development consulting services, can design solutions tailored to your business and deliver measurable results.
If your current tools feel limiting, it might be time to invest in a solution built specifically for your needs.





